Key responsibilities
BIM/VDC project leadership
- Align BIM/VDC scope, schedule, budget, and staffing with overall project goals.
- Lead BIM/VDC execution from pursuit and preconstruction through construction and closeout, including BIM Execution Plans, model coordination strategies, and deliverable schedules.
- Serve as primary BIM/VDC point of contact for owners, design teams, contractors, trade partners, and internal staff.
- Establish QA/QC protocols for models, documentation, and coordination milestones; identify risks early and recommend mitigation strategies.
- Support and guide Project Leads in running multidisciplinary coordination meetings, clash detection workflows, constructability reviews, and issue resolution; stay actively engaged while empowering Project Leads to own day-to-day meeting leadership.

Technology, standards & process improvement
- Develop and maintain BIM/VDC standards, templates, workflows, and best practices across projects and offices.
- Continuously evaluate and select BIM/VDC software — including Autodesk, Bluebeam, and comparable platforms — to advance the firm's pursuit of leading industry workflows and production.
- Drive innovation in Revit and coordination workflows, extending the firm's established leadership in scanning and reality capture; implement automation, dashboards, and emerging technologies (4D scheduling, digital twins, reality capture, prefabrication).
- Train and mentor project teams on coordination processes, tools, and digital delivery expectations.

Required q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Architecture, Engineering, Construction Management, or related field; equivalent experience considered.
- 8+ years in BIM, VDC, construction technology, or digital project delivery; 3+ years leading BIM/VDC on complex AEC projects.
- Demonstrated experience supporting client relationships, pursuits, proposals, or presentations.
- Advanced proficiency with Revit, Navisworks, Autodesk Forma, and similar platforms.
- Experience developing BIM Execution Plans, clash detection workflows, and model standards.
- Strong communication, facilitation, and presentation skills; ability to manage multiple projects and stakeholders.
Preferred qualifications
- Experience in healthcare, commercial, higher education, infrastructure, or mission-critical sectors.
- Existing client or industry network within [target geography / market sector].
- Experience with 4D/5D integration, digital twins, laser scanning, reality capture, or prefabrication workflows.
- Familiarity with Power BI, automation, scripting, or model-based analytics.
- Experience with project scheduling (e.g., Primavera P6 or Microsoft Project).
- Professional certifications: CM-BIM, PMP, DBIA, LEED AP, or Autodesk certification.
